How it’s Made
All ice-dyed pieces are individually hand-dyed by me as the artist. I usually choose 4-6 colors and even when I dye several items in one container, no two look alike. Ice dyeing takes at least 24 hours and because I'm using ice not hot water, the colors in the dye separate and create new colors as well as blending with neighboring colors.
